    59, ACKERS HALL AVENUE, LIVERPOOL, L14 2DX

    This terraced leasehold property on Ackers Hall Avenue last sold in March 2021 for £79,500. Based on price growth in the L14 district since then, its estimated current value is £93,053 — placing it in the 3rd percentile nationally and the 6th percentile within L14. The property covers 71 m² (764 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£1,311 per m². The EPC rating is C, with a potential rating of B.
